PRLog -- Many organizations deem May to be the month of Small Business and go out of their way to provide specialized opportunities to help entrepreneurs create, implement tactics, and plan for their growth. From May 16th to May 18th, The Brands + Bands Strategy Group Founder, Nadia Vanderhall was in Washington D.C. for Meta's Meta Boost Gather 2022. When Meta shifted its parent name from Facebook in 2021, the social experience platform sought additional ways to support small businesses, with this event being just one of the many ways that it has kept its promise thus far.
As one of the 500 Leaders that were flown out for this year's event, courtesy of Meta, Vanderhall also networked with other business owners and learned to boost her business with key Meta integrations. She was also in a small group of North Carolina Business owners who spoke with Congressman Dan Bishop, emphasizing the importance of, and how better programming and funding would help Small Businesses thrive beyond the 2-5 year threshold. Other Leaders also had opportunities to meet with their policy makers from their own respected States.
Vanderhall became a member of the Leaders Network Group in 2022, with much of the growth of her business being aided by the key products that sit under the Meta brand. Her admission was preceded by an audio interview with a member of the platform, Anglea Yee. When asked about how she felt the Gather experience would impact her business, Vanderhall responded, "The pandemic really was the 'Great Reset' for a lot of entities and Small Businesses weren't excluded. From how we do business to how we connected with each other and customers were shifted. Being at Gather allowed us to get 'offline' to learn how to build more strategically online. Using Meta's product suite and integrations have been pivotal to my business success, so Gather gave me more of a 'boost'.
